Misted double glazing

If your double-glazed windows develop mist, it can be very unattractive and impact the clarity of the view you get from the window. It can also be a sign that your windows are not properly sealed or properly insulated. This can cause you to spend more on energy because you have to heat the home more. Double glazing that is misted can be repaired for an affordable cost.

The reason you see misting in double-glazed windows is actually condensation, that builds up between the two panes of glass that form your double glazing. This is a frequent issue and is caused by a variety of factors. It usually occurs when the air in the room becomes too humid, resulting in water vapour condensing on cold surfaces. It can also be caused when the seals or glass fail. It could be a serious issue in both cases and is worth fixing it as soon as possible.

A cloudy appearance in the middle of the window can be an indication that the double glazing is clouded. This is often caused by the accumulation of moisture between the glass panes, and is often difficult to remove without removing the entire window unit. But, you can try wiping the inside of the glass with a an abrasive cloth to see whether this helps.

Broken panes

It is recommended to clean your double-glazed window at least once per year with a mild soap. Avoid harsh chemicals that may damage the seals. Avoid using a high pressure washer on your windows as the water can enter the sash, leading to leaks. If you do decide to use chemicals, make sure they're safe and use them sparingly.

It is essential to repair the damaged window as soon as possible. It's not just a safety issue, but it could also affect your home’s energy efficiency. This could result in higher utility bills. A damaged window can allow cold air to enter your home and warm air to escape, resulting in significant energy loss.

Thankfully, fixing a cracked or broken window isn't a big task however, it will take some time and effort. First, you'll need to take out any old glass and glazing points. You can do this using a putty knife, pliers or a screwdriver with a flat-head. Wearing eye protection, carefully pull out the old glazing points. After the old glazing is removed, clean the L-shaped channel around the window frame. Sand any wood that is bare to a smooth finish and seal with linseed or clear wood sealer.

The next step is cut the pane into the proper size. You can either use the template on paper with pencil or the edge of a pane that is intact to guide. Utilize a glass cutter and a razor to cut out the new pane of glass. Once the broken window is gone and replaced, you can replace it with a brand new pane of glass, along with the glazing points and glazing compound.

Sagging double glazing

Double glazing is a popular choice for many homes due to its energy efficiency. It helps keep heat in the home and stops cold air from escaping making your house warm and cosy. Over time, the windows can lose their insulation properties, particularly if not properly maintained. The seals and frames may deteriorate and lead to problems with condensation, draughts, or even leakage.

If your double-glazed windows don't perform correctly, you must first verify if they're still covered by the warranty. If they're still under warranty, the company that installed them should be able come out and reseal your windows for no extra cost.

Many businesses repair and replace damaged double-glazing, if your windows are not in warranty. They can visit your property and seal your windows, and restore their insulation. They can also get rid of the condensation and restore a clear view between the glass panes.

The most frequent issue with double-glazed windows is that they can form condensation between the panes of glass. This can be caused by a variety of things that include a lack of ventilation within the building or in the room as well as high levels of humidity. To prevent condensation, it is recommended to keep the humidity at a minimum and install vents or extractors in the window frames to allow fresh air into the room.

If you're experiencing condensation or draughts it is likely that the seal on your double-glazed window has failed. A damaged seal can result in an increase in insulation, which can increase heating bills. If you're not sure if your seals have failed or not, run your hands over the window frame to determine if it is cold and drafty. This could be an indication that seals have failed, as well as an oversaturated Desiccant in the sealed unit.

The Desiccant absorbs moisture that is present in the air. When the Desiccant is saturated, it will begin to degrade. White snowflakes of dust can be observed floating around the sealed unit. This is a clear indication that the seals are failing and that need to be replaced.
